Description
This paper discusses the linear complexity property of binary sequences generated using matrix recurrence relation defined over Z4. Generally algorithm to generate random number is based on recursion with seed value/values. In this paper a linear recursion sequence of matrices or vectors over Z4 is generated from which random binary sequence is obtained. It is shown that such sequences have large linear complexity.
